pg电子块视频,解析与制作指南pg电子块视频
本文目录导读:
随着电子游戏的不断发展,视频内容已经成为了游戏制作中不可或缺的一部分。pg电子块视频作为一种特殊的视频格式,因其独特的结构和表现形式,逐渐成为游戏制作中的重要工具,本文将从pg电子块视频的定义、历史背景、制作流程以及未来发展趋势等方面进行详细解析,并提供实用的制作指南,帮助读者更好地理解和运用这一视频格式。
什么是pg电子块视频?
pg电子块视频(Progressive Geometric Block Video,简称PG电子块视频)是一种特殊的视频格式,主要用于表示游戏中的场景切换和动画效果,与传统视频文件(如MP4、AVI等)不同,PG电子块视频是一种基于几何模型的动画格式,主要用于游戏引擎中的动画插件(如Unreal Engine、Unity等)。
PG电子块视频的核心特点是其高度优化的几何结构,通过将动画分解为多个几何块,可以实现高效的动画渲染和性能优化,这种格式特别适合用于需要频繁加载和切换场景的游戏,因为它能够显著降低游戏运行时的内存占用和渲染时间。
PG电子块视频的历史与发展
PG电子块视频的概念最早可以追溯到20世纪90年代,当时一些早期的3D游戏引擎开始尝试通过优化动画数据来提高渲染效率,随着游戏引擎技术的不断进步,PG电子块视频逐渐成为主流动画格式之一。
2000年后,随着DirectX和OpenGL技术的成熟,PG电子块视频在游戏制作中的应用更加广泛,许多游戏制作人开始意识到,使用PG电子块视频不仅可以显著提升游戏性能,还能在开发过程中大幅减少资源浪费。
近年来,随着游戏引擎技术的进一步优化,PG电子块视频已经成为许多主流游戏引擎的默认动画插件格式,Unreal Engine 4和Unity 3D都支持PG电子块视频格式,这使得这一视频格式在游戏制作中占据了越来越重要的地位。
PG电子块视频的制作流程
制作PG电子块视频是一个复杂而精细的过程,需要结合动画设计、几何建模和渲染优化等多个方面,以下将详细介绍PG电子块视频的制作流程。
动画设计与建模
在制作PG电子块视频之前,首先需要进行动画设计和几何建模,动画设计是整个制作过程的基础,它决定了视频的最终效果和表现形式,常见的动画设计方式包括:
- 关键帧动画:通过定义多个关键帧,描述动画的起始状态和结束状态,从而生成中间的动画效果。
- 物理模拟动画:通过模拟物理现象(如重力、碰撞、流体等)来生成逼真的动画效果。
- 混合动画:结合关键帧动画和物理模拟动画,以实现更复杂的动画效果。
几何建模是动画制作的重要环节,它决定了动画的几何结构和细节,在PG电子块视频中,几何建模需要特别注意以下几点:
- 几何结构:动画需要分解为多个几何块,每个几何块需要定义其形状、位置和运动方式。
- 层次结构:几何建模需要遵循一定的层次结构,以便在渲染过程中高效地处理动画数据。
- 动画约束:通过定义动画约束(如关节、骨骼等),可以实现更复杂的动画效果。
动画编码与压缩
PG电子块视频的制作离不开高效的动画编码和压缩技术,由于PG电子块视频是一种特殊的几何动画格式,其编码过程需要特别注意以下几点:
- 几何压缩:通过压缩几何数据(如顶点坐标、法线向量等),减少视频的文件大小。
- 动画压缩:通过压缩动画数据(如运动向量、时间戳等),进一步减少视频的文件大小。
- 压缩格式选择:根据具体的压缩需求,选择合适的压缩格式(如MPEG-4、AV1等)。
渲染与优化
在动画制作完成后,需要通过渲染引擎对动画进行渲染和优化,渲染过程包括以下几个环节:
- 几何渲染:将几何块渲染为2D图像,生成动画的每一帧。
- 光照与阴影:通过模拟光照和阴影效果,增加动画的立体感和真实感。
- 渲染优化:通过优化渲染参数(如光线追踪、阴影计算等),提高渲染效率。
测试与调整
在渲染完成后,需要对PG电子块视频进行测试和调整,测试环节主要包括:
- 性能测试:通过模拟游戏运行环境,测试视频的渲染性能和内存占用。
- 效果测试:通过对比不同的动画效果,确保视频的视觉效果符合预期。
- 调整优化:根据测试结果,对动画进行必要的调整和优化。
PG电子块视频的注意事项
在制作PG电子块视频时,需要注意以下几点:
-
几何结构的合理性
几何结构是PG电子块视频的基础,必须确保几何块的形状和运动方式符合动画效果的需求,复杂的几何结构可能会导致渲染性能下降,因此需要在设计时充分考虑优化。 -
动画约束的严格性
动画约束需要严格定义,以确保动画效果的连贯性和自然性,松散的动画约束可能会导致动画效果不流畅,甚至出现卡顿。 -
压缩格式的选择
压缩格式的选择需要根据具体的压缩需求来决定,如果文件大小是主要考虑因素,可以选择高效的压缩格式;如果动画效果是主要考虑因素,可以选择低压缩格式。 -
渲染引擎的兼容性
PG电子块视频需要与游戏引擎兼容,因此需要选择支持PG电子块视频的渲染引擎,常见的支持PG电子块视频的渲染引擎包括Unreal Engine、Unity 3D等。
PG电子块视频的未来发展趋势
随着游戏引擎技术的不断发展,PG电子块视频的应用场景也在不断扩展,PG电子块视频的发展方向包括:
-
更高的几何复杂度
随着计算能力的提升,未来的PG电子块视频可能会更加注重几何复杂度,以实现更逼真的动画效果。 -
更高效的压缩技术
随着压缩技术的不断进步,未来的PG电子块视频可能会采用更高效的压缩技术,以进一步减少文件大小。 -
更强大的渲染引擎支持
随着渲染引擎技术的不断进步,未来的PG电子块视频可能会支持更多的渲染引擎和几何建模工具,以提高制作效率。 -
更多样化的动画效果
未来的PG电子块视频可能会更加注重动画效果的多样性和自然性,以满足不同游戏的需求。
pg电子块视频作为一种特殊的视频格式,因其高度优化的几何结构和高效的渲染性能,成为游戏制作中不可或缺的工具,本文从定义、历史、制作流程、注意事项以及未来发展趋势等方面进行了详细解析,并提供了一篇完整的制作指南,希望本文能够帮助读者更好地理解和运用PG电子块视频,为游戏制作提供更多的灵感和参考。
pg电子块视频,解析与制作指南pg电子块视频,
发表评论